Output 8fe05849e755dfc224782db986e2c78b430b398209db1ebe9ac2bd40e1fc02b4:3

value
28980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c462944e58069c77c0a18dc0ef1ff513e4dc00e9 OP_EQUAL
address
3KbQTZ5ANvsyT1UDFey3AGPZXdGoB4cQA3
transaction
8fe05849e755dfc224782db986e2c78b430b398209db1ebe9ac2bd40e1fc02b4
confirmations
503801
spent
true